QDHS—NOVEL CORONAVIRUS The Department of Health have advised that if a student has been in contact with someone who has contracted the Novel Coronavirus, they should seek medical advice and stay away from school until they are clear of symptoms for 14 days. As an extra precaution, if a student has travelled to or through China or Hong Kong in the past two weeks, parents are asked to keep them away from school, on a voluntary basis, for a period of 14 days from the date they returned to Perth.

SHIRE OF QUAIRADING We are currently seeking ‘Expressions of Interest’ to rent a unit at Arthur Kelly Village. Arthur Kelly Village is situated on the west end of Jennaberring Road by Parker House. The units are fantastic for retirees who are looking to reside in a smaller living space. They include a kitchen, lounge/dining room, 1 bedroom with en-suite bathroom. The units

also include reverse cycle air conditioning and a small garden. If you are interested in occupying one of these units please contact Britt Hadlow at the Shire of Quairading on 9645 2400. ADMINISTRATION OFFICER Kylagh Cattle Company is a long established and well known WA Cattle business based 25kms North of Quairading. We are seeking an Administration Officer to join our team at Kylagh Feedlot. The key responsibility of this role is to provide administrative support to all facets of the feedlot and cattle trading operation. This support will include managing the livestock database, receiving, collating and disseminating data and records gathered by others, preparing and processing invoices, processing cattle sales and purchases transactions, cattle and feed commodities contract management and general office management.
